What Are Soffits?


Soffits are the horizontal surface areas that connect the exterior wall of a building to the roof overhang. Typically discovered beneath eaves, they serve several purposes:

Value of Soffit Maintenance


Routine maintenance of soffits is vital for a number of reasons:

  1. Preventing Damage: Well-maintained soffits serve as a barrier versus water intrusion, insects, and debris buildup. Neglecting them can cause substantial damage.
  2. Increasing Energy Efficiency: Properly ventilated soffits lower heat accumulation in the attic during the summer season, enabling better total energy performance.
  3. Enhancing Curb Appeal: Clean and well-kept soffits can significantly boost a home's exterior look.
  4. Avoiding Costly Repairs: Proactive maintenance can conserve property owners from substantial repairs and replacements down the line.

Soffits Maintenance: Best Practices


1. Routine Inspections

House owners ought to inspect soffits a minimum of twice a year, ideally in spring and fall. Search for signs of wear and damage, such as loose boards, cracks, or water discolorations. Special attention ought to be provided after severe weather condition occasions.

2. Cleaning

Cleaning up soffits is vital to remove dirt, mold, and debris.

3. Repair and Seal

If evaluations reveal damage, act promptly. Repair cracks with an ideal sealant developed for the soffit product. For larger issues, consider changing the affected areas or consult an expert.

4. Enhance Ventilation

Ensure soffit vents are unobstructed to enable air flow. Eliminate any debris or greenery blocking these areas. This is particularly essential for keeping temperature balance and wetness levels in the attic.

5. Pest Control

Inspect for indications of insects, such as chewed wood or droppings. If insects are detected, think about calling a bug control expert. Pull away plants near your house that might provide access to pests.

6. Painting

Routine painting assists protect wood soffits from moisture and boosts their look. Usage exterior-grade paint and apply it every few years or when you notice peeling or fading.

Frequently Asked Questions about Soffits Maintenance


Q1: How typically must I clean my soffits?A1: Cleaning soffits should be done a minimum of once a year but can be done more often if they collect dirt or mold. Q2: What is the very best method to repair damaged soffits?A2: For

minor damages, use caulk or sealants ideal for your soffit material. For extensivedamage, consider replacing the affected sections. Q3: Can I paint my soffits?A3: Yes, painting wooden soffits is recommended to protect against wetness.

Make sure to use exterior-grade paint designed for outdoor conditions. Q4: Are vinyl soffits worth the investment?A4: Yes, vinyl soffits need less maintenance compared to wood, withstand wetness, and offer durability.

Q5: What must I do if my soffits are rotting?A5: Rotted soffits typically need to be replaced. Check the underlying structural products and seek advice from a professional if required. Soffits are an integral part of
